Excerpt from An Historical Sketch of the First Church in Roxbury The prayers were frequently an hour long, the ser mons of even greater length, measured by an hour glass, when clocks and timepieces were rare; and it is told of one of the ministers of New England that, when the sands were run out, he would look over his sleepy congregation, and say, Come, friends, let's take another glass. Excerpt from Historic Sketch of the First Church of Christ in Wethersfield: Given From the Pulpit July 9, 1876 But if we are first we shall have to admit that it is because we were a little more willful and impatient of authority than our neighbors. People of Watertown, Dorchester, and Newtown, all petitioned the General Court of the Bay Colony for leave to emi grate. The Court refused, at first, the permission it afterwards granted; but we, the Watertown people, had made up our minds to come, and so came, regardless of the General Court, and were on the ground, a few of us, and built our huts in the fall of 1634. But this was only preparatory, and you must come to 1635 and 1636 to see the three settlements really established. The journey of these little communities across the country, and the hardships which attended the first settlement, ought not to be soon forgotten by their children. Men, women, and chil dren making their way on foot through a hundred and twenty miles of pathless forests, over mountains, and through thickets, swamps, and streams. - a fortnight on the way, - the Windsor people not reaching their destination till November, and in that same month the river frozen over; the winter one of great severity, not as fatal, but attended with as great hardship and suffering, as the first at Plymouth; household supplies, sent around by water from Boston, greatly delayed, and much utterly lost; starvation threatened; some of the people making their way back through the forest to Massachusetts, others by way of the river and the sea; the remnant, with what supplies they have, and with what they obtain from the forest, just managing to live through.
